From: Tom MacWright Date: Mon, 10 Jun 2013 19:46:48 +0000 (-0700) Subject: Remove unnecessary abstraction around rectangles X-Git-Tag: live~4838^2~58 X-Git-Url: https://git.openstreetmap.org/rails.git/commitdiff_plain/7d84b81fd953e7a9965330c67f3e42701000fb19 Remove unnecessary abstraction around rectangles --- diff --git a/app/assets/javascripts/browse.js b/app/assets/javascripts/browse.js index 24fe5171e..a5738e1ba 100644 --- a/app/assets/javascripts/browse.js +++ b/app/assets/javascripts/browse.js @@ -33,7 +33,12 @@ $(document).ready(function () { [params.maxlat, params.maxlon]); map.fitBounds(bbox); - addBoxToMap(bbox); + + L.rectangle(bbox, { + weight: 2, + color: '#e90', + fillOpacity: 0 + }).addTo(map); $("#loading").hide(); $("#browse_map .geolink").show(); diff --git a/app/assets/javascripts/index.js b/app/assets/javascripts/index.js index 0e3e7cd56..8d3a043d6 100644 --- a/app/assets/javascripts/index.js +++ b/app/assets/javascripts/index.js @@ -48,7 +48,11 @@ $(document).ready(function () { map.fitBounds(bbox); if (params.box) { - addBoxToMap(bbox); + L.rectangle(bbox, { + weight: 2, + color: '#e90', + fillOpacity: 0 + }).addTo(map); } } else { map.setView([params.lat, params.lon], params.zoom); diff --git a/app/assets/javascripts/map.js.erb b/app/assets/javascripts/map.js.erb index 80e77f26c..b3ac299f0 100644 --- a/app/assets/javascripts/map.js.erb +++ b/app/assets/javascripts/map.js.erb @@ -151,18 +151,6 @@ function addObjectToMap(object, options) { }); } -function addBoxToMap(bounds) { - var box = L.rectangle(bounds, { - weight: 2, - color: '#e90', - fillOpacity: 0 - }); - - box.addTo(map); - - return box; -} - function getMapBaseLayer() { for (var i = 0; i < layers.length; i++) { if (map.hasLayer(layers[i].layer)) {